New York, NY (June 30, 2025) – Path of Liberty: That Which Unites US, a powerful public art installation made possible by The Soloviev Foundation, will welcome active, off-duty, and retired military members and their families this Independence Day as the nation begins the official countdown to America’s 250th birthday. Situated along the East River, the installation offers a meaningful backdrop for the celebration and live simulcast of the annually anticipated Macy’s Fireworks Show.

Dessoff ChoirsNew York, N.Y. (June 30, 2025)  The Dessoff Choirs – led by Music Director Malcolm J. Merriweather – today announces its 2025-2026 season. Fresh off its 100th anniversary season in 2024-2025, The Dessoff Choirs has been a fixture on the New York classical music scene, known for introducing unknown, long-forgotten, or newly composed works to American audiences, while Dessoff’s nine music directors have continued expanding founder Margarete Dessoff’s legacy.

Downtown Albany BIDAlbany, NY — Summer has officially arrived in downtown Albany, bringing with it a variety of free, family-friendly events to enjoy this season. The Downtown Albany Business Improvement District (BID) has organized several activities throughout the next few months, including State Street Yoga, Downtown Albany BINGO, Tunesday, and Live Score Movie Nights. These events are open to the public at no cost and aim to promote exploration, tourism, community engagement, and interactive experiences in downtown Albany. …

A Midsummer Night’s DreamShakespeare’s Classic Comedy Painted in Colors as Never Before 

July 17-27, 2025 (8 performances), Thursday, Friday, Saturday 7pm / Sunday 2pm 

New York, N.Y. (June 26, 2025) – Ensemble Shakespeare Company (ESC), New York City’s innovative ensemble for classical theater, presents A Midsummer Night’s Dream, Shakespeare’s classic comedy told with the company’s unique and intimate style of storytelling. ESC Executive Director Dylan Diehl* directs an ensemble cast of fifteen, including Chloe Champken, Dylan Diehl, Susannah Hoffman*, Dennis Kear*, Gerrard Lobo, Jesse Cao Long, Paul Marchegiani, Diego Millan, Celeste Moratti, Ella Olesen*, Katie Pelensky, Erin Roth*, Joe Staton, Lawrence E. Street*, and Colleen Smith Wallnau*. Eight performances will be staged from July 17-27, 2025, at the Flea Theater, 20 Thomas Street, New York, NY 10007.

NY Festival of SongFour-Concert Mainstage Series Co-Presented with Kaufman Music Center at Merkin Hall Begins November 20

Season Additionally Includes NYFOS Next Festival at The Theater at 150 W 17 and NYFOS Residency at The Juilliard School

New York, N.Y. (June 26, 2025) — New York Festival of Song (NYFOS), led by Artistic Director Steven Blier, today announces its 2025–26 season of performances, including four Mainstage Series programs at Merkin Hall, co-presented with Kaufman Music Center. The season also includes the ​​NYFOS Next Festival at The Theater at 150 W 17 and NYFOS’s annual residency at The Juilliard School.

Hammondsport Village Square and Keuka Lake courtesy Explore SteubenHammondsport, N.Y. — A town gets its character from the buildings that line its streets and the people who call it home. For decades, small towns across the country have been fading away. Though a handful, here and there, manage to preserve the traditions and charm of bygone days while still moving toward the future. One such town nestled at the southern tip of Keuka Lake has been garnering accolades for over 160 years now, yet many people are still not aware of the community’s rich history. You might expect an architect to appreciate the historical relevance of a building. Or even a neighborhood of buildings. But thanks to local architect and historic preservationist, Elise Johnson-Schmidt, the Village of Hammondsport, long celebrated for its innovation and architectural charm, has received a prestigious honor.

Greene County Tourism Visitor Welcome CenterGreene County, N.Y. - The Greene County Legislature is proud to announce the official opening of its new visitor center taking place on Thursday, July 3, 2025 at 11AM.

“This major development project began well before I came to work for Greene County” notes James Hannahs, Director of Economic Development, Tourism & Planning. “In 2016, then Deputy County Administrator Warren Hart and then Executive Director of the Greene County IDA, Rene VanSchaack worked closely with the Greene County Legislature to acquire long underutilized properties with great potential on both the east and west sides of the NYS Thruway at Exit 21 in Catskill.”…

Lucky CharlieRevered Chef Nino Coniglio of Williamsburg Pizza and Coniglio’s in Morristown, NJ opens a new restaurant with the oldest coal oven in America

New York, N.Y.Lucky Charlie, the new pizza restaurant and bar from award-winning chef Nino Coniglio (Williamsburg Pizza, Coniglios), is opening on June 27 in Bushwick, Brooklyn at 254 Irving Ave., between Bleecker and Menahan. The restaurant, which is home to the oldest coal oven in America, is inspired by New York pizzerias of the 1920s and Nino’s Sicilian heritage, and features a selection of pizzas that highlight Italian-imported ingredients, alongside a seasonally-rotating menu of meat, seafood, and oven-baked pasta dishes.

Bronx Night MarketNew York’s most beloved open-air food and culture festival announces its final season before sunsetting in October 2025

Bronx, NY — After eight groundbreaking years of redefining community, flavor, and open-air celebration in the Bronx, the Bronx Night Market will take its final bow this fall. The 2025 season will mark the last run for this historic market, with five final events at Fordham Plaza beginning June 28 and closing with an epic farewell on October 25.
